To replace the lower Intake Manifold, release the cooling system and supercharge. As the next step, remove the radiator inlet hose from the water outlet housing, even remove the exhaust gas recirculation (EGR) outlet pipe bolt and the egr outlet pipe from the lower Intake Manifold. Detach the engine coolant temperature (ECT) sensor electrical connector and remove the lower Intake Manifold bolts before removing the lower Intake Manifold, then the coolant bypass tube will also be released. The next step is removing the lower Intake Manifold seals and gaskets and if changing the manifold also removing the water outlet housing and Thermostat, as well as ect sensor. Check on the flatness on the inlet flanges and the mating surfaces on the lower Intake Manifold and the Intake Manifold bolt and bolt holes for any adhesive compound. Case of installation take note, if the ect sensor is removed, install using torque to 25 nm (18 ft. Lbs.). Then, if required, install the Thermostat, gasket and water outlet housing while tightening bolt and stud to 27 nm (20 ft. Lbs.). Replace the Intake Manifold gaskets and apply, gm p/n 12346286(Canadian P/N 10953472) or equivalent, on the extremities of the intake seals before putting the lower Intake Manifold seals. Prepare the bypass tube adjusted from the manifold opening and put the lower Intake Manifold in place (with lower Intake Manifold bolts followed by lower Intake Manifold bolts), tightening respectively from the center to the outside in sequence to 15 nm (11 ft. Lbs). Connect the ect sensor electrical connector back, connect the egr outlet pipe and its bolt, tighten it to 29 nm (21 ft. Lbs.). Finally replace the radiator inlet hose, the supercharger, top up the cooling system, and check for the fluid or vacuum leaks.
